Kevin Lisbie signs for Barnet

Barnet have signed 36 year old striker, Kevin Lisbie following his release by Leyton Orient. Lisbie's last season with Orient was hampered by injuries and he had a loan spell at Stevenage.

Lisbie began his career at Charlton where he progressed through the youth system to the first team and 176 appearances scoring 16 goals and also had loan spells with Gillingham, Reading, QPR, Norwich & Derby before joining Colchester in 1997.

Lisbie scored 17 goals in 43 appearances for the Essex club before moving to Ipswich Town a year later for £600,000. Lisbie struggled to establish himself at Portman Road and was loaned back to Colchester where he 13 goals in 43 appearances in season 2010/11. He also had a loan spell with Millwall before joining Leyton Orient in the summer of 2011. Lisbie scored 48 goals in 125 appearances for Orient.
